The HDMs demethylate histones pathway (Reactome ID: R-HSA-3214842) involves 6 genes and is affected by 9 compounds in the BiohacksAI evidence corpus. Compound-pathway associations are derived from target overlap: a compound is linked to this pathway if it targets ≥2 genes within the pathway.
